Title: **The Innovative Contributions of Inventor Günther Lorenz**

Introduction

Günther Lorenz, based in Übach-Palenberg, Germany, stands out as a talented inventor with a significant contribution to the field of packaging technology. With a total of three patents to his name, Lorenz demonstrates a commitment to improving the functionality and efficiency of packaging solutions.

Latest Patents

Among Günther Lorenz's latest patents is the innovative "Packaging container made of a sheet-like composite with improved adhesion-layer and inner-layer combination." This invention focuses on a container that effectively separates its interior from the external environment and is constructed from a specialized sheet-like composite.

Additionally, he has developed a "Container formed from a container blank and having improved opening properties as a result of stretching heat treatment of polymer layers." This particular invention discloses a container that includes at least one hole and outlines the process for its production. The container is crafted from a composite that consists of multiple layers including a polymer outer layer, a carrier layer, a barrier layer, an adhesive layer, and a polymer inner layer, with specific techniques applied during the creation process to enhance its functionality.
